如何校验TP钱包签名:全面指南和实用技巧

          引言

          在区块链和加密货币的世界中,TP钱包作为一种重要的数字资产管理工具,成为了越来越多用户的选择。随着对数字资产的依赖增加,了解如何校验TP钱包签名显得尤为重要。签名校验不仅关系到资产的安全性,还关系到用户交易的真实性和可靠性。本文将全面分析TP钱包签名校验的必要性、相关原理以及步骤。

          为什么需要校验TP钱包签名?

          
如何校验TP钱包签名:全面指南和实用技巧

          签名校验是区块链技术中的一项核心机制。它确保了交易的安全性和所有权的真实性。具体来说,校验签名有以下几个重要目的:

          1. **防止伪造交易**:通过校验签名,网络可以确认某一笔交易是否由其声称的发起者发出,从而防止了恶意用户伪造交易。

          2. **保障用户权益**:对于持有数字资产的用户来说,校验签名可以有效保障其所有权,防止因为系统漏洞或其他攻击导致资产被盗。

          3. **提升交易的透明度**:签名校验的过程让交易变得更加透明,参与者可以清楚地知道每一笔交易的发起和参与者,增强了信任度。

          4. **顺应法规趋势**:随着各国对区块链和加密货币的监管逐步加强,签名校验成为合规交易的必要步骤。

          TP钱包签名的工作原理

          TP钱包的签名校验依赖于公钥加密技术。用户在进行交易时,会用其私钥对交易信息进行签名,形成一个唯一的签名。交易的接收者可以利用发送者的公钥对签名进行校验,以确认交易的合法性。具体过程如下:

          1. **交易准备**:用户发起一笔交易,需要传入的参数包括接收者地址、转账金额等。

          2. **生成签名**:交易信息经过哈希处理后,使用用户的私钥进行签名,从而生成交易的数字签名。

          3. **发送交易**:携带签名的交易信息被广播到网络上。

          4. **签名校验**:接收者或网络节点通过发送者的公钥和签名信息对交易进行校验,确认其有效性。

          如何进行TP钱包签名校验?

          
如何校验TP钱包签名:全面指南和实用技巧

          在进行TP钱包签名校验时,用户需要一些工具和方法。以下是具体步骤:

          1. **获取交易信息**:首先,需要获取被签名的交易信息,包括交易数据和签名。

          2. **获取公钥**:为了完成签名校验,你需要获取发送者的公钥。公钥一般在用户生成TP钱包时会被保留。

          3. **使用校验工具**:你可以使用一些开源库或工具,例如 BitcoinJS、EthereumJS 等库,这些都提供了签名校验的功能。

          4. **执行校验过程**:在代码中使用相关 API 进行签名校验,根据返回结果(成功或失败)来判断交易的有效性。

          5. **记录校验结果**:将校验结果进行存档,有助于后续的审计和数据分析。

          常见问题解答

          1. TL;DR(Too Long; Didn't Read)我能简要看看TP钱包签名校验步骤吗?

          答:首先,要获取交易信息和发送者公钥,然后使用合适的工具进行校验,如果结果为真即确认有效。

          2. TP钱包的签名校验有什么风险?

          答:如果公钥泄露或私钥被盗,那么攻击者可以伪造交易,造成损失。用户应妥善保管自己的私钥。同时,使用不安全的工具或库也可能引发安全隐患。

          3. 我需要编程基础才能理解签名校验吗?

          答:虽然了解编程基础会更方便进行签名校验,但许多钱包和工具提供了用户友好的界面,普通用户也可以通过简单的操作完成校验。

          4. 一旦签名校验失败,我应该怎么做?

          答:签名校验失败意味着交易的合法性受到质疑,建议谨慎行事,并核查所有相关信息,必要时联络技术支持或专家。

          5. 我可以使用哪些工具进行TP钱包签名校验?

          答:可以使用多种开源库(如 BitcoinJS 和 EthereumJS)来校验签名。同时,一些在线服务也提供此类功能,注意选择信誉良好的平台。

          6. 如何提高TP钱包的安全性?

          答:应定期更改密码、开启双重认证、妥善保存私钥、保持软件及安全防护的最新状态,以此来提高钱包的安全性。

          总结

          TP钱包签名校验是确保数字资产安全的重要环节,对每一个用户来说,了解及掌握这一过程都有助于提升其自身的安全意识和交易的透明度。随着区块链技术的进一步发展,安全性的重要性也愈发显著。希望通过本文,各位用户能够不仅理解什么是签名校验,更能够有效地实施相应的步骤,保护好自己的数字资产。未来,随着技术的进步和监管政策的完善,相信TP钱包的使用体验将会更加安全与便利。

          总字数约3700字(至此展现的内容为摘要,实际文本需进一步扩充到所需字数)。
              author

              Appnox App

              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                        related post

                        
                                
                                    
                                        

                                    leave a reply